There has never been a better time to build on your existing qualifications with a globally recognised MBA (Top-up) degree. You will study a cross-cutting โstrategicโ module, designed for practising managers looking to take the step upwards by considering contemporary ideas in a global context.
The development and implementation of strategy and how you can sustain both yourself and the organisation you manage in the future are themes you will explore. This will be followed by a work-based project in a relevant area of your choice providing you with the opportunity to add value to your employer and enhance your CV.
Accreditation
Upon completing your course, you'll gain a Level 7 Certificate in Strategic Leadership andanagement alongside your MBA degree at no additional cost, which puts you on the fast track to Chartered Manager status. You'll also receive free CMI membership throughout your studies, which permits access to exclusive resources, mentoring services, as well as networking events.
